info@russellipm.com
+44 1244 281 333
Stored Product Insect
Russell IPM is a leading manufacturer of innovative biorational products including insect pheromone-based monitoring and control systems.
Home
Corporate Site
About
Insects
Dismate
XLure
QLure
Safestore
Tobaguard
Media Centre
Contact
Insects, Warrehouse Cocoa Moth
Ephestia elutella
, Warehouse Cocoa Moth
26 May 2017 -
Insects
,
Warrehouse Cocoa Moth